Mike, I agree with Peter's notion that LEAF is basically a specialized Linux distribution. Developers create packages that are either included into a "release" or "branch". In that sense, LEAF is basically like Debian or what have you, but specialized towards the use of routing.
For the moment LEAF's package subsystem is 'ok' when there are only a handful of packages. But when the list of packages continues to grow and the interdependencies become more complex, the current LRP package system wont hack it. Seems to me that the LEAF project would vastly benefit from adopting the recent Debian Mini-Distribution for Diskless Routers (http://www.debian.org/News/weekly/2003/27/). In other words, create a Debian LEAF distribution that trims the fat from Debian, but otherwise adopts the benefits of debian's package system. Of course, this will likely require a leap away from being a floppy-based linux router. However, I would argue that limiting LEAF to a floppy-based installation is going to kill it in the long-run. In fact, the WISP distribution of LEAF already requires more space than what fits into a single floppy. And, as Peter mentioned, more packages are being continuously developed and added --- which is a good thing! Just my $0.02.
